I can't wait to see it with the painted body. It all looks so great so far how did you make the tail light holders?

Tailight holders were made from .032 thick aluminum, came from my hobby shop in 4x10 inch sheets and cost 3 dollars. I could probably make about 5 pairs from that one sheet. I used construction paper to make a template, made my bends in the paper first and layed out my holes with marks. Then I traced the template on the aluminum and marked the holes with a centre punch. I drilled the holes first(4, with a cordless drill)then cut out with a jigsaw, filed to smooth and debur, made my bends with needle nose pliers, very simple and cheap to make.
